Express Toll Lanes Ready To Open On I-25

by Lynn Carey
DENVER (CBS4) ― State and federal government leaders attended a ceremony Thursday to celebrate Friday's planning opening of the express toll lanes on Interstate 25. The lanes will allow solo drivers to use the HOV lanes on I-25 from the Boulder Turnpike into downtown.

Drivers who want to use the toll lanes will need an electronic transponder like the one used by drivers on E-470 and the Northwest Parkway.

Gov. Bill Owens and Acting Federal Highway Administrator J. Richard Capka attended Thursday's ceremony.

The lanes were set to open to traffic on Friday at noon.

Officials said Colorado was becoming one of only four states in the nation currently operating this type of facility. The hope was that the express lanes would ease traffic and maximize the capacity of the highway.

Carpools, buses and motorcycles will continue to use the HOV lanes for free.
